Transaction b154681aab89d903c638e933f9a238dafa7c14f6334512cac56ecb7843f85ed2
1 Input
1 Output
-
b154681aab89d903c638e933f9a238dafa7c14f6334512cac56ecb7843f85ed2:0
- value
- 23395610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27a21c3327e8cb57b79b46d56da7e6723d3fd954 OP_EQUAL
- address
- 35JaUdrUef9Te3XhXGfJKqrXWq2dcZbtCV